Within the last week, my Toshiba Canvio Basics external hard drive is no longer recognized by my computer. When I plug it in, I get the beep from Windows and the drive spins up, but it doesn't show up under My Computer or Disk Management. I do see it if I look under Device Manager > Disk Drives.
My first thought was that it was a problem with the hard drive itself. However, when plugging it into my laptop, it shows up right away. I've tried every USB port (3.0 and 2.0) on my desktop, but it doesn't work. However, all of my other devices (keyboard and mouse, controller, and other external hard drive) work in each of the ports.
I am not sure on whether it is a problem with the hard drive or my desktop. Any suggestions?
